#779492 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#779492 is composed of 46.7% red, 58% green and 57.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 19.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 1.4% yellow and 42% black. It has a hue angle of 175.9 degrees, a saturation of 11.9% and a lightness of 52.4%. #779492 color hex could be obtained by blending #eeffff with #002925. Closest websafe color is: #669999.

Shades and Tints of #779492
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050707 is the darkest color, while #fbfcfc is the lightest one.

Tones of #779492
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#808b8a is the less saturated color, while #10fbeb is the most saturated one.
